The Conversion Process: Pounds to Kilograms
The conversion factor between pounds and kilograms is approximately 2.20462 pounds per kilogram. So naturally, this means that one kilogram is equal to roughly 2. 20462 pounds. To convert pounds to kilograms, you simply divide the weight in pounds by this conversion factor.
Let's apply this to our example: converting 112 pounds to kilograms.
112 pounds / 2.20462 pounds/kilogram ≈ 50.78 kilograms
So, 112 pounds is approximately equal to 50.78 kilograms.

A Brief History of Weight Measurement
The history of weight measurement is long and complex, evolving over millennia. In real terms, early civilizations used various rudimentary methods, often based on readily available objects like grains of barley or seeds. The Roman pound, libra pondo, became a significant influence, eventually evolving into the avoirdupois pound used in the Imperial system.
The Metric system, developed in France during the late 18th century, aimed to create a unified and standardized system of measurement. It's based on the decimal system, making calculations and conversions relatively straightforward. The kilogram, defined as the mass of a platinum-iridium cylinder kept in Sèvres, France, became the fundamental unit of mass.
